我的前端实习之旅

在大学的最后一年,我获得了一个宝贵的机会------在一家外包公司担任前端开发实习生。这一经历不仅让我得以将所学知识应用于实践,还教会了我许多课本之外的重要课程。

加入公司的第一天,我就意识到学术和职业环境之间的差异。我被分配到一个正在开发新项目的团队,并负责辅助实现用户界面。初始的几周,我的主要任务是学习和理解项目架构,以及如何使用公司采用的现代前端框架。公司做移动端主要用的是uniapp,后台用的vuecli脚手架,elementplus前端框架,还有官网。

在实习期间,我学到了以下几点重要的经验:

  1. 技术栈的实际应用: 在学校里,我们学习了HTML, CSS和JavaScript等基础知识,但只有在实际项目中,我才真正理解如何将这些工具综合运用。例如,通过使用Vue框架,我学会了如何高效地构建用户界面组件,以及如何管理应用状态。时代更新的很快,在实习的时候用的是Vue2.0,到现在已经开始使用Vue3.0了

  2. 版本控制系统的重要性: 实习前,我仅有基础的使用Git的经验。而在实习中,我几乎每天都需要使用Git来协作,这不仅提高了我的技术能力,也让我认识到版本控制在团队协作中的重要性。

  3. 响应式和自适应设计: 之前我只在模拟项目中接触过这些概念,而在实习公司,我必须确保我们的应用在各种设备上均表现出色。设计并实现在小至手机,大至桌面显示器上都能优雅工作的界面,这对我的编码和设计能力都提出了更高要求。

  4. 团队协作与沟通: 前端开发者常常需要与设计师、产品经理和后端开发者密切合作。我学会了如何清晰地沟通想法,并学习了如何给出并接受有用的反馈。

  5. 持续学习和适应新技术: 前端领域不断发展,新工具和框架层出不穷。我意识到,要在这个领域成功,就必须不断学习和适应新技术。我的导师经常推荐我阅读相关文档和教程,这帮助我保持了技术的前沿性。

  6. 问题解决能力: 在实习中,我遇到了很多棘手的问题,例如跨浏览器兼容性问题、性能优化等。我学到了如何分析问题、寻找可能的解决方案,以及实施这些解决方案。

实习结束时,我不仅在技术层面有了显著提升,更重要的是,我开始懂得如何作为一个专业人士在团队环境中工作。这段经历为我后续的职业生涯打下了坚实的基础,我感激在实习中学到的一切,并期待将来在前端开发领域中继续成长和创新。

在即将结束的今天,我鼓励每位读这篇文章的学生,如果有机会,一定要抓住实习的机会。它是你职业生涯中一段无价的经历,能够为你的未来铺设坚实的基石。

希望这篇文章对您有帮助。

相关推荐
Heo几秒前
深入 React19 Diff 算法
前端·javascript·面试
滕青山1 分钟前
个人所得税计算器 在线工具核心JS实现
前端·javascript·vue.js
小怪点点2 分钟前
手写promise
前端·promise
国思RDIF框架11 分钟前
RDIFramework.NET Web 敏捷开发框架 V6.3 发布 (.NET8+、Framework 双引擎)
前端
Mintopia12 分钟前
如何在有限的时间里,活出几倍的人生
前端
炫饭第一名13 分钟前
速通Canvas指北🦮——变形、渐变与阴影篇
前端·javascript·程序员
Neptune114 分钟前
让我带你迅速吃透React组件通信:从入门到精通(上篇)
前端·javascript
阿懂在掘金14 分钟前
Vue 表单避坑(一):为什么 v-model 绑定对象属性会偷偷修改父组件数据?
前端·vue.js
小码哥_常19 分钟前
Android与JS交互:解锁混合开发的魔法之门
前端
leafyyuki23 分钟前
如何优雅地上传大文件?分片上传实战指南
前端·音视频开发